Electricity

• Electricity is the flow of electrons through a conductor

• Electricity will only move through a closed circuit, if the circuit is broken the flow of electrons stops

Electricity (cont.)

• Voltage - Electric potential or potential difference, provided by the battery, expressed in volts

• Amperage - The strength of an electric current, flows through the conductors to the load, expressed in amperes

• Resistance - Is present in any load, expressed in ohms

Light to Power

• Solar Panels collect sunlight and convert them into electrical power

• For maximum power solar arrays need to be perpendicular to the light rays hitting them.

Orbit Cycle

• During the 30 minute eclipse period the batteries supply power

• While in insolation period the solar arrays provide power while the batteries charge for the next eclipse period

Primary and Secondary power

• Primary power is high voltage power generated at a centralized source

• Before power is delivered to users it is stepped down by a transformer to a set voltage (secondary power)

• Secondary power is then delivered to the user

SPDA/RPDA/DDCU

• Secondary Power Distribution Assembly– Supports a single channel of power

• A is even channel B is odd channel

– Routes power to one RPDA and six loads

• Remote Power Distribution Assembly– Routes power to six loads

• Direct current to Direct current Converter Unit– This is the unit that converts primary power (~160 V

dc) to secondary power (~124 V dc)

MBSU/ICC

• Main Buss Switching Unit– Each support 2 channels of power with a total

of 200 amps– Routes power to two SPDAs

• Interconnecting Cables– Create a bridge for two or more MBSUs to

share power across them

IEA

• Integrated Equipment Assembly

• Battery Charge Discharge Unit (BCDU)– When signaled by the ECU the BCDU begins

charging or discharging the batteries

• Batteries (BAT)– Batteries store power for use during the eclipse

phase of the station’s orbit

IEA (continued)

• Direct Current Switching Unit (DCSU)– Routes power from BGA to batteries, IEA, and

Internal system

• Direct current to Direct current Converter Unit (DDCU) – Provides Secondary power for all components.

IEA Thermal control system

• IEA has a self contained thermal control system for each channel

• Small radiators under each IEA dissipate heat from the SSU as well as batteries and other IEA components

• This system functions in the same manner as the main TCS for the station

• Pump and Flow Control Subassembly (PFCS) and Photovoltaic Radiator (PVR)

ECU/SSU

• Electronic Control Unit– Manages when to charge and discharge the

batteries

• Sequential Shunt Unit– Shunts any excess power generated as heat– Small radiator beneath each PVA radiates heat

Grounding

• To prevent electricity from arcing across the station all electrical devices are grounded to the main truss.

• Plasma Contractor Unit (PCU)– Emits a stream of plasma to ground the space

station’s main truss to space– Prevents arcing to any external spacecraft

during docking or EVA

BGA/PVA

• Beta Gimbal Assembly– Rotates one channel of power per BGA– Controls rotation perpendicular to the main

station truss

• Photovoltaic Array– Collects sunlight and converts it into electrical

power
